Dr. Charles German MD, MS, FAHA, FASPC is an Assistant Professor at Georgetown University and is the Director of Preventive Cardiology at Medstar Georgetown University Hospital/Medstar Heart and Vascular Institute. He is a board-certified cardiologist and cardiovascular epidemiologist, with research expertise in physical activity, coronary calcium scoring, risk assessment, and cardiometabolic disease, with publications in JAMA, JACC, and Hypertension. He has served on the Physical Activity and Obesity councils for the American Heart Association (AHA), and helped plan the AHA's preventive cardiology programing for scientific sessions over the past 2 years. He also serves on the Board of the American Society for Preventive Cardiology, having chaired the clinical practice statement entitled "Defining Preventive Cardiology."
